How to prepare for a job interview at Job Search Place Limited
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you understand the role of an Early Careers Recruiter. Familiarise yourself with high-volume recruitment processes and the importance of building relationships with universities. This will show your potential employer that you're genuinely interested in the position.
✨Showcase Your Communication Skills
As communication is key in this role, prepare to demonstrate your skills during the interview. Think of examples where you've effectively communicated with candidates or stakeholders. Practising clear and concise responses will help you shine.
✨Research the Company
Dig into Job Search Place Limited’s values, mission, and recent achievements. Being able to discuss how your personal values align with theirs will set you apart. Plus, it shows that you’re proactive and gen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Prepare Questions
Interviews are a two-way street, so come armed with thoughtful questions about the company culture, recruitment strategies, and how they measure success in this role.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
